Momus is a name that has its roots in Greek mythology. In Greek mythology, Momus was the god of satire, mockery, and criticism. He was known for his sharp tongue and his ability to find fault in everything. The name Momus is derived from the Greek word "momos," which means blame or fault. Momus was often depicted as a mischievous and cynical figure, and his name has come to be associated with criticism and satire.

Are there any notable figures named Momus?

Yes, there is a notable figure named Momus in the music industry, specifically a Scottish musician and songwriter known for his eclectic style. He has released numerous albums and is recognized for his clever lyrics and unique sound. His work often reflects the satirical essence associated with the name Momus.
